Output 50d22dc08b4d19cc4e53cc77487e3a2247e464ad74cb33870a27511713338bb2:12

value
621579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 517bebda8ba66afad4bdd90dd5c4737b77ae4600 OP_EQUAL
address
397s7HVSBzaAedHrrn8f8YYsLEU7LeHSsE
transaction
50d22dc08b4d19cc4e53cc77487e3a2247e464ad74cb33870a27511713338bb2
spent
true